You can try a fluid with friction modifiers in it. We use Case IH Hy-Tran
in our race powerglides. It has a strong friction modifier and really firms
up the shifts. This might solve your problem (at least temporarily) if it's
actually a clutch slippage problem.

>> Generally, just draining and filling will not cause
> this condition, but a
>> flushing will.
>> In our cases, the Black fluid means the Friction
> Material has worn off the
>> Clutches and Brakes and become suspended in the
> fluid, providing the
>> friction needed to keep the car moving. By draining
> the fluid, you
>> removed too much of the Friction Material, and now
> the 'naked' clutch
>> plates have nothing to grab onto.
>>
>> This is a pretty grave situation, as it means
> removing the tranny from the
>> car and tearing it down to replace the friction
> surfaces. About $1200 and
>> no guarantees! (I can't understand how a tranny shop
> can charge so much
>> and then not work!).
